Output e3dbeaae6825823e0c2a1df63461e5c403cd2e7d83e350b25425830d33090081:0

value
25335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afd2bbc986af37b4b66dee7240f735357b62f16 OP_EQUAL
address
3Qa897vTiGVyJy6zoz9wG6raxXzZ5FxXnk
transaction
e3dbeaae6825823e0c2a1df63461e5c403cd2e7d83e350b25425830d33090081
spent
true